Investigation Summary
At 3:54 p.m. on February 23, 2022, an employee was working for a landscaping service. His employer, the service, was at the site conducting commercial landscaping activities, specifically picking up debris and edging in and around a hospital adjacent to the site of the incident. The employee was mulching leaves in a parking lot approximately 50 yards (46 meters) north of the incident location. At the end of the work shift, the employee exited the parking lot and began operating a 2019 60 inch (1.5 meter) Exmark Turf Tracer model number TTX650EKC604N0 mower, with serial number 404399281. The mower had a sulky attachment for the operator to stand on. He was headed south along the curb of a boulevard toward an avenue. The employee was driving in a two-lane roadway. There was no shoulder. The employer had no traffic control measures in place. The employee was headed to the firm's trailer, parked uphill. When the employee was near an unnamed driveway leading to the hospital, he was struck from behind by a motor vehicle at a stop sign. He was pinned between the motor vehicle and a utility pole at the corner of the unnamed driveway in front of him. The employee's leg was amputated below the knee. The narrative did not specify if the leg was amputated at the time of the incident or later, during surgery. The employee was hospitalized.
